Transaction 621669be21c8227bd2efb7def3d13c63d37892681e0f50511c99c76a0748a295

1 Input
2 Outputs
  • 621669be21c8227bd2efb7def3d13c63d37892681e0f50511c99c76a0748a295:0
  • value  486817
    address  1seM998dfDVA8JwUcjrr8jD2eGuz5onTe
  • 621669be21c8227bd2efb7def3d13c63d37892681e0f50511c99c76a0748a295:1
  • value  3389965
    address  1NZ5qbandfAdUbiNZb9fKnLER3o59v9cdd